Job Description
- Preparing monthly carrier bills and payments along with the underlying reconciliation.
- Processing monthly client payments through our online bank portal; maintaining our financial application, recording those monthly payment transactions, and monitoring balances.
-Generating monthly employer billing for our channel partner client.
- Consulting clients on standard support processes and reporting, while considering client nuances.
- Proactively identifying, researching, and resolving discrepancies between all parties: bswift, the client and carriers
- Acting as an internal control check point by performing routine audits and checks to confirm data credibility, analyzing data for consistency, accuracy, and reasonableness.
- Identifying appropriate cross-functional and external stakeholders to resolve client system / data errors, determining root cause, communicating to client, and making appropriate updates.
- Ensuring the timely and high-quality completion of all activities and communications required to maintain compliance and raving fans.
- Managing Open Enrollment activities specific to billing services, including auditing new plans and rates.
- Ensuring that internal systems and process documentation are maintained and kept up to date, including our billing platform and client procedures.

Required Qualifications
- Three to five years of experience in client account management
- Experience with reconciling activities.
- Strong Microsoft Excel skills (V-Lookup, Pivot Tables, etc.)
- Familiarity with internal controls processes
- Strong communication skills, ability to be client-facing
- Self-starter with a positive personality who can contribute to the bswift culture, demonstrates initiative and eagerness to learn

Preferred Qualifications
- Client account management experience in the benefits admin or insurance space
- Solid understanding of accounting principles

Education
Bachelor’s Degree in Finance or Business
